Given our local climate with hot summers and variable humidity, common issues include cooling system failures (thermostats, water pumps), early wear on batteries due to heat, and air conditioning compressor problems. Older BMW models also frequently require attention for oil leaks from valve cover and oil filter housing gaskets, which can be exacerbated by our stop-and-go traffic on routes like GA-11.
Look for shops in Bethlehem or nearby Barrow County that specialize in European automobiles and have BMW-specific diagnostic tools like ISTA. Check for certifications such as ASE Master Technicians with BMW experience and read local reviews on Google or Nextdoor that mention long-term reliability. A quality local shop will use OEM or high-quality aftermarket parts and be transparent about their labor rates.
Labor rates in Bethlehem and the surrounding Barrow/Gwinnett area are typically lower than at Atlanta dealerships but can vary. A fair independent shop rate for BMW-specific expertise currently ranges from $120 to $150 per hour. Overall costs are influenced by the complexity of repairs and parts sourcing, but using a trusted local independent shop often provides significant savings over the dealership without sacrificing quality.

The mix of rural roads, highway commuting on GA-316, and seasonal pollen/dust requires attentive maintenance. We recommend more frequent cabin air filter changes to manage allergens and pollen, and closer monitoring of tire wear and suspension components due to occasional rough road conditions. Following the BMW Condition Based Service (CBS) system is advised, but be prepared for potential accelerated wear on cooling components from our summer heat.
